Prepaid Cellular Phone Service By Josh Riverside There are two kinds of cellular services: pre-paid and post-paid. The post-paid service is one where the customer enters into a contract with the service provider and pays for the airtime used after a monthly bill is generated. In contrast, a pre-paid connection works through a system of charge cards.
If the customer has subscribed to a pre-paid plan, he will need to buy a recharge card that will credit his account with some airtime. The customer can use the connection until the airtime is available. Once the customer exhausts all the airtime he needs to go out and purchase another recharge card to make outgoing calls and receive incoming calls.
Pre-paid connections are hassle-free, though the calling rates are usually higher than post-paid plans, and some services may be unavailable to pre-paid users. The pre-paid market is growing at a very fast pace. Several people are opting for pre-paid plans, especially those who make limited use of their cellular phones.
A pre-paid connection doesn’t require the customer to go through credit checks, and most service providers do not even charge any monthly service fees. Customers also don’t pay any security money. This makes pre-paid connections a good option for people with limited financial resources. The paperwork required for a pre-paid connection is also less, and there is no signing of a contract or verification involved. Customers don’t even need to reveal their real name and identity when applying for a pre-paid connection. This anonymity has made pre-paid connections rather infamous,

as they can be used for unscrupulous activities.
A pre-paid connection is also very useful for people who travel frequently. If the customer is traveling to another country he will need roaming activated on his post-paid connection. The call costs and security costs are much higher for this roaming service. Sometimes it is just easier to buy a pre-paid connection in the country you are traveling to.
It is not surprising that pre-paid connections are getting more popular, with so many advantages to offer. However, every customer must consider his or her requirements before opting for the hassle-free pre-paid option.
